diff --git a/.gitlab-ci/container/build-crosvm.sh b/.gitlab-ci/container/build-crosvm.sh index 45e49741b31..9adfcdaaa38 100644 --- a/.gitlab-ci/container/build-crosvm.sh +++ b/.gitlab-ci/container/build-crosvm.sh @@ -1,6 +1,13 @@ #!/usr/bin/env bash # shellcheck disable=SC2086 # we want word splitting +# When changing this file, you need to bump the following +# .gitlab-ci/image-tags.yml tags: +# DEBIAN_BASE_TAG +# DEBIAN_TEST_GL_TAG +# DEBIAN_TEST_VK_TAG +# KERNEL_ROOTFS_TAG + set -uex uncollapsed_section_start crosvm "Building crosvm" @@ -8,7 +15,7 @@ uncollapsed_section_start crosvm "Building crosvm" git config --global user.email "mesa@example.com" git config --global user.name "Mesa CI" -CROSVM_VERSION=1641c55bcc922588e24de73e9cca7b5e4005bd6d +CROSVM_VERSION=2118fbb57ca26b495a9aa407845c7729d697a24b git clone --single-branch -b main --no-checkout https://chromium.googlesource.com/crosvm/crosvm /platform/crosvm pushd /platform/crosvm git checkout "$CROSVM_VERSION" diff --git a/.gitlab-ci/image-tags.yml b/.gitlab-ci/image-tags.yml index 02c849ba4a2..e66baf9b434 100644 --- a/.gitlab-ci/image-tags.yml +++ b/.gitlab-ci/image-tags.yml @@ -13,7 +13,7 @@ variables: DEBIAN_X86_64_BUILD_BASE_IMAGE: "debian/x86_64_build-base" - DEBIAN_BASE_TAG: "20241122-sections" + DEBIAN_BASE_TAG: "20241125-crosvm" DEBIAN_X86_64_BUILD_IMAGE_PATH: "debian/x86_64_build" DEBIAN_BUILD_TAG: "20241122-sections" @@ -28,9 +28,9 @@ variables: DEBIAN_X86_64_TEST_ANDROID_IMAGE_PATH: "debian/x86_64_test-android" DEBIAN_TEST_ANDROID_TAG: "20241121-deqp-main" - DEBIAN_TEST_GL_TAG: "20241121-deqp-main" - DEBIAN_TEST_VK_TAG: "20241121-deqp-main" - KERNEL_ROOTFS_TAG: "20241121-deqp-main" + DEBIAN_TEST_GL_TAG: "20241125-crosvm" + DEBIAN_TEST_VK_TAG: "20241125-crosvm" + KERNEL_ROOTFS_TAG: "20241125-crosvm" DEBIAN_PYUTILS_IMAGE: "debian/x86_64_pyutils" DEBIAN_PYUTILS_TAG: "20241002-pyutils"